在Excel宏(VBA)中使用RESTful API,可以通过以下步骤实现:
以下是一个示例代码,演示如何在Excel宏中使用RESTful API发送GET请求并解析响应数据:
Sub CallAPI()
Dim xmlhttp As Object
Set xmlhttp = CreateObject("MSXML2.XMLHTTP")
Dim url As String
url = "https://api.example.com/endpoint"
xmlhttp.Open "GET", url, False
xmlhttp.Send
If xmlhttp.Status = 200 Then ' 请求成功
Dim response As String
response = xmlhttp.responseText
' 解析响应数据
' ...
MsgBox "API调用成功!"
Else
MsgBox "API调用失败!错误代码:" & xmlhttp.Status
End If
End Sub
需要注意的是,具体的API调用方式和参数设置需要根据实际情况进行调整。此外,为了保证数据的安全性,建议在使用RESTful API时使用HTTPS协议进行通信。
对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,建议在实际应用中根据需求选择适合的云服务提供商的产品和文档进行参考和学习。
领取专属 10元无门槛券
手把手带您无忧上云